Get a key fob

Key fobs are small remote that lets you control a vehicle's system. It's battery-powered and has an internal chip that sends signals to the car that allow it to unlock the doors or start the engine. The majority of modern cars require a key fob to function. You can buy them at the dealer, or from a locksmith. Finding the right one for your car could be a bit difficult. It might require a few tries however, if you're patient you can get the right one for your vehicle.

The latest fobs are usually dark gray or black and have buttons. They can range in price from $50 to $100. Fobs that have additional features such as push-button starter or keyless entry will cost more. Fobs with an LCD display can cost up to $1,000. The majority of bumper-to-bumper warranties for new cars and auto club memberships will cover key fobs that are replaced however you must verify your specific policy.

You should replace your key fob as soon as possible when it's lost. A key fob could be costly to replace, and if you don't have a spare, may not be able drive your vehicle.

This method can be used to program car keys a key fob either at home or in the office. The procedure will differ from vehicle to car, but the basic steps are the same. First, you must remove the old keyfob. Then, you should replace the battery. This is typically a small watch or calculator battery, which you can purchase in the majority of home improvement stores and pharmacies.

You should program the new key fob within a certain time frame, which is usually about 10 to 30 seconds. This can be done by pressing both the lock and unlock buttons at the same time. When the car has recognized the new key fob it will turn off the door locks or sound a chime to indicate that the process is complete.

A lot of cars require specific chips in their keys as an additional security measure. These chips make it difficult to duplicate keys and are exclusive to the car they're linked with. This is a great thing, but it could make it difficult to replace stolen or lost keys, since the chip needs to be reprogrammed.

Get a locksmith

Whether you need to program your car keys or you would like to install an intercom system for your apartment, you can find the right locksmiths to help. They can also provide suggestions on security upgrades. Some locksmiths specialise in specific locks, while other locksmiths can install a whole new security system. They can also rekey existing locks to accept new keys.

Most people call a locksmith because they have locked themselves out of their house or office. It could happen when people forget their keys or close the door behind them. Locksmiths can unlock the lock using master keys, or an key that jiggles. They can also cut new keys for doors, windows and safes.

Locksmiths often have to utilize special software and computers to program the keys for automobiles. These programs are often very complex and must be maintained regularly. Locksmiths also need to purchase a large number of tokens for the computer systems. This can be expensive.
